Hello, I am new here to the forum . I am planning to put 8 15" speakers on my Chevy c1500 But I don't know if i could put them all @ 1ohm load ???. Can someone let me know if it could be done before I purchase the subs...

Yes you series each individual speaker than you parallel them all together.
